    Job Description

    Homecare GPS is a growing software and service company located in Worcester, MA. Homecare GPS software is used to help Home Health Agencies be more compliant and efficient with their back-office operations, clinical documentation, and billing. We offer clients a more personalized service experience and believe that their success is our success.

    The Client Services Specialist will help satisfy the needs of our clients and our internal operations with excellence in service and accuracy in execution. They will begin by learning the details of our software and the billing services we provide and increase in the breadth and depth of their contribution over time as they develop their working knowledge. The Client Services Specialist will primarily support the weekly and on-going Client Billing Services activities, learning all aspects related to billing of services and interacting with many different websites and tools to process and track claims and provide detailed reporting. They will also be one of the first points of contact for client support, help with web-based training and perform other activities as needed. They will be part of a small, high functioning team in a dynamic, fast paced environment. Client support is primarily provided by phone and web-based tools.

    The Client Services Specialist position demands a high functioning, detail-oriented individual with strong administrative and communication skills and technical abilities to contribute to our client’s experience and success. Much of the work is data-driven and the services we provide impact our clients’ revenue, compliance, and operations. Therefore, it is not enough to just do a job task. A successful candidate will possess a genuine interest in understanding the purposes and implications of their work and have critical thinking skills that will help towards diagnosing issues, providing solutions, and contributing to the overall success of the company.

    Industry-specific experience is not required. We will train someone who has proven to have the right skills, and they will need a curiosity and patience to learn and grow over time. They must be able to work very well both independently and as a coordinated member of our team.
